本站所有资源均为高质量资源,各种姿势下载。
椭圆曲线密码(ECC)协处理器是一种专为加速ECC运算而设计的硬件解决方案。该系统最突出的特点是采用了双域处理架构,能够同时支持素数字段和二进制字段的运算,这在加密应用中具有重要价值。
该处理器的核心创新在于其标量乘法器的实现方式。标量乘法作为ECC中最耗时的关键运算,其性能直接影响整个加密系统的效率。该设计采用256位位宽的串行和并行混合操作模式,在时钟速率执行时实现了显著的性能提升。
控制单元的设计体现了对功耗优化的考量,在提供高吞吐量的同时保持低功耗特性。这种平衡使得该协处理器特别适合需要高性能密码运算的嵌入式场景。
硬件实现方面,开发团队采用Verilog硬件描述语言进行编程,并选择Xilinx Vertex II Pro作为目标平台。验证流程使用了Modelsim XE 6.1e仿真工具,确保了设计的正确性和性能指标的可信度。
性能评估表明,相较于同类解决方案,该架构在运算时间和芯片面积两方面都取得了优势,为椭圆曲线密码学的硬件加速提供了新的参考设计。